Households

In Kodiak (Kodiak Island Borough), AK, the aggregate number of households is 5,729

 

Median Income

Households in the city of Kodiak (Kodiak Island Borough), AK have a median income of $62,953.

 

Population

The total population in the city of Kodiak (Kodiak Island Borough), AK is 13,562

 

DSL Technology

Approximately 96.22% of consumers in the city of Kodiak (Kodiak Island Borough), AK have access to DSL internet

 

Fiber Technology

Approximately 0% of consumers in the city of Kodiak (Kodiak Island Borough), AK have access to fiber-optic internet.

 

Cable Technology

Approximately 92.07% of consumers in the city of Kodiak (Kodiak Island Borough), AK have access to cable internet.

 

Wireless Technology

Approximately 98.1% of consumers in the city of Kodiak (Kodiak Island Borough), AK have access to mobile broadband internet.

 

Average upload speed

For residents in the city of Kodiak, AK, the city-wide average upload speed is 4 Mbps

 

Average download speed

For residents in the city of Kodiak, AK, the city-wide average download speed is 7 Mbps.

Cable Internet in Kodiak, AK

Compare Cable Internet Service in Kodiak, AK

Cable Internet is a very popular service, and out of the many different options available, it's one of the best. The companies that provide cable Internet also offer TV and phone services, which makes it easier to bundle the services. In Kodiak, AK, cable Internet is delivered through a physical network of fiber-optic or coaxial cables, and when the Internet is set up by a technician, a physical connection is made between the subscriber and cable company. A cable modem provides an Internet connection, and it uses the bandwidth from television channels. Since cable Internet uses the same bandwidth that TV channels use, it's easily bundled with a television service. When compared with TV channels, an Internet connection uses only a small amount of bandwidth, and most cable companies in Kodiak, AK offer it. Depending on their needs, consumers can bundle their TV, phone and Internet services from a single company, and by bundling, they might be able to save money. Unlike DSL, the quality of a cable connection isn't affected by the distance between the service station and consumer.

In many cases, it will make better financial sense to bundle services, but some services might be cheaper when purchased individually. High-speed cable Internet in Kodiak, AK is ideal for customers who don't share a cable line with anyone else. However, in some areas, the connection won't be as strong because it must be shared with other subscribers. The way the cable network is designed causes subscribers to share a physical connection, so the activity of one user can slow down the connection for everyone else. However, despite the connection sharing, high-speed cable Internet can still be very fast and reliable.

Compare Fiber Optic Providers in Kodiak, AK

Compare Fiber Optic Internet Providers in Kodiak, AK

What is all the talk about fiber optic Internet about? Fiber optic Internet services, often referred to as “FiOS,” use fiber optic cables to transmit data using light, instead of electricity. On the cutting edge of digital technological advances, fiber optic cables can transmit data at speeds approaching the speed of light with minimal signal loss or weakening across large distances. However, this does not mean that your actual download speeds will approach futuristic light speed levels. Fiber optic cables only ensure strong and reliable connections between traditional electric hubs, and your internet service will likely still be limited by electronic hardware such as your router or Internet service provider. Fiber optic networks are often seen as the most “future proof” internet connection and may provide superior download speeds and ultra-low latency in certain areas of Kodiak, AK.

Compare DSL Internet Providers in Kodiak, AK

Kodiak, AK DSL Internet Providers

Digital Subscriber Line is commonly known as DSL internet. It is a mode of internet connection that uses telephone lines. Users get access to bandwidth by using analog telephone lines that enable transmission of frequency signals. DSL internet differs from cable internet because it uses extra bandwidth from the phone lines to connect to the web. The first step of using DSL internet is connecting your computer to a DSL modem. The modem establishes a connection to the service provider via the analog telephone line. The service provider then uses a Digital Subscriber Line Access Multiplexer (DSLAM) to connect to the internet. MyRatePlan enables you can compare different DSL providers in Kodiak, AK.

DSL is advantageous because it allows clients in Kodiak, AK, to access the internet with little bandwidth. Moreover, a customer can use DSL connection to make phone calls and browse the internet at the same time. The quality of the internet signal is not affected by many users logging in at once because it has no effect on DSLAM. Therefore, DSL internet provides fast internet services to many DSL units in an area. The primary concern of using DSL internet is that the quality of the connection is affected by the distance between the user and the provider's office. If the user is far from the provider's office, he/she may find it difficult to use DSL. Potential customers need to check the quality of DSL connection in the area and remember that they have to install a phone line to set up a DSL connection.

Find Satellite Internet Service Providers in Kodiak, AK

Kodiak, AK Satellite Internet Service

The final option to consider for Internet service in Kodiak, AK is satellite, and this connection operates differently than cable or DSL. To start using a satellite Internet connection, you must have a functional satellite dish, and you'll also need a modem. When facing the equator, the satellite dish sends and receives data from satellites in space. Once a connection is established, the Internet can be used.

Satellite isn't the fastest Internet option in Kodiak, AK, but it can work well for consumers who live in rural or remote areas. Cable and phone companies aren't located in many remote areas, and in these situations, satellite Internet might be the only service available.
